ABOUT THE COLLEGE: CMC is an elite liberal arts college 35 miles from Los Angeles. The Robert Day School has a faculty of 32, including professors in economics, finance, and accounting. CMC offers undergraduate degrees in economics and economics/accounting, and a master's degree in finance and research institutes that support faculty research http://www.cmc.edu/institutes. The College is part of the Claremont University Consortium, which includes undergraduate colleges (Harvey Mudd College, Pitzer College, Pomona College, and Scripps College) and graduate schools (Claremont Graduate University, the Keck Graduate Institute of Applied Life Sciences, and the Peter F. Drucker Graduate School of Management). Our web site provides additional information: http://www.cmc.edu/rdschool
